Readjustment of petroleum product prices: Government outlines mitigating measures
A joint press conference was held with the Minister of Communication, Government Spokesman, and five other ministers in the auditorium of the Ministry of Communication on Tuesday February 6
Sequel to the new price readjustment of certain petroleum products, the Cameroonian government is implementing a series of measures to mitigate the effects of this increase on the population. This was the subject of a joint press conference held by the Minister of Communication, René Emmanuel SADI, accompanied by his government colleagues.

Race of Hope 2022: New winner emerges
Elvis Nsabinlah and Tatah Carine have written their names in the golden book of the race of hope, by emerging as winner in the senior male and female categories respectively in the 27th edition of the Mount Çameroon Race of Hope. Elvis Nsabinlah, who won the race for the first time completed the 39KM race in 4hrs 32 mins while three times winner, Tatah Carine clinched her 4th title by completing the race in 5hrs 28 minutes.
